What is an Associate Data Center Capacity Engineer?

Associate Data Center Capacity Engineers are entry-level professionals who assist in managing and planning the capacity needs of data centers. Their responsibilities include monitoring resource usage, forecasting future requirements, and helping to optimize space, power, and cooling to ensure efficient operations. They often work under the guidance of senior engineers to analyze trends, prepare reports, and support infrastructure upgrades or expansions. This role is critical in ensuring that data centers can meet growing demands without overextending resources.

What does an Associate Data Center Capacity Engineer do?

As an Associate Data Center Capacity Engineer, your daily tasks will often include monitoring data center resources, analyzing current and projected capacity needs, and assisting with infrastructure planning. You'll collaborate closely with senior engineers, operations teams, and facility managers to ensure that power, cooling, and space requirements are met for both current and future workloads. Additionally, you may contribute to reporting, document capacity trends, and help identify areas for optimization to maintain efficiency and reliability within the data center.

What is the difference between Associate Data Center Capacity Engineer vs Data Center Technician?

AspectAssociate Data Center Capacity EngineerData Center Technician
Primary FocusCapacity planning, infrastructure analysis, optimizing data center resourcesHardware installation, maintenance, troubleshooting
Required SkillsData analysis, understanding of data center infrastructure, basic networkingHardware skills, troubleshooting, physical installation
Work EnvironmentOffice and data center environment, collaborative planningData center floors, hardware racks, physical setup
CertificationsData center or networking certifications (e.g., CCNA, CompTIA Network+)Hardware certifications (e.g., CompTIA A+)

The Associate Data Center Capacity Engineer primarily focuses on capacity planning and infrastructure optimization, requiring analytical skills and certifications in networking. In contrast, Data Center Technicians handle hardware installation and maintenance, working directly within the data center environment. Both roles are essential but differ in scope and responsibilities.
